How the Indus River Basin Faces Water Scarcity During Extended Drought Periods

The Indus River Basin is a vital water source for millions of people, supporting agriculture, industry, and daily life. However, extended drought periods pose significant challenges to water availability in the region. Understanding these impacts helps in developing strategies for sustainable water management.

Causes of Water Scarcity in the Indus Basin

Several factors contribute to water scarcity during droughts. Climate change has led to reduced snowfall in the Himalayas, which diminishes the flow of the Indus River. Additionally, over-extraction of water for agriculture and urban use depletes available resources. Population growth further increases demand, intensifying the strain on water supplies.

Impacts of Extended Droughts

Extended droughts result in lower river flows, affecting water availability for irrigation and drinking. Reduced water levels can lead to the deterioration of water quality and increased competition among users. Agricultural productivity declines, which can threaten food security and economic stability in the region.

Strategies for Mitigation

Effective management of water resources is essential to address scarcity. Strategies include implementing water conservation practices, investing in efficient irrigation systems, and promoting rainwater harvesting. Transboundary cooperation among countries sharing the Indus River is also crucial for equitable water distribution during drought periods.
